Wood strip and a faded-pink fiberboard barrel. The lightweight barrel has a hinged lid that is stenciled with the text "B.A. Railton Co. Value Blend Coffee 100 LBS. Chicago - Milwaukee"
Stenciled on the side of the barrel is the text "Mrs. W.H. Allen, Tourist Home, Saugatuck Mich."Context
In 1901, William and Flora Allen bought the collection of buildings that became the Tourist Home resort. In 1933, the hotel changed its name to the Mount Baldhead Hotel.
B.A. Railton Co. was a coffee wholesaler that served hotels. In 1985, B.A. Railton Co., a (then) Northlake-based food distribution firm was acquired by Sysco Corp. (Source Chicago Tribune - https://www.chicagotribune.com/1985/10/24/ba-railton-co-becomes-subsidiary-of-sysco-corp/)Collection
